From 0b35004a85e8a5b28f6683cbd509291e4cb56a51 Mon Sep 17 00:00:00 2001 From: Joel Koshy Date: Wed, 18 Feb 2015 15:55:24 -0800 Subject: [PATCH] Add constructor to javaapi to allow constructing explicitly versioned offset fetch request --- core/src/main/scala/kafka/javaapi/OffsetFetchRequest.scala | 8 ++++++++ 1 file changed, 8 insertions(+) diff --git a/core/src/main/scala/kafka/javaapi/OffsetFetchRequest.scala b/core/src/main/scala/kafka/javaapi/OffsetFetchRequest.scala index 1c25aa3..12d3dd0 100644 --- a/core/src/main/scala/kafka/javaapi/OffsetFetchRequest.scala +++ b/core/src/main/scala/kafka/javaapi/OffsetFetchRequest.scala @@ -28,6 +28,14 @@ class OffsetFetchRequest(groupId: String, correlationId: Int, clientId: String) { + def this(groupId: String, + requestInfo: java.util.List[TopicAndPartition], + correlationId: Int, + clientId: String) { + // by default bind to version 0 so that it fetches from ZooKeeper + this(groupId, requestInfo, 0, correlationId, clientId) + } + val underlying = { val scalaSeq = { import JavaConversions._ -- 1.7.12.4